MR imaging is the method of choice for diagnosis, surgical planning, and evaluation of PVNS [ 14, 15, 32, 33 ]. Characteristic MR imaging features of PVNS enable a diagnosis to be made in 83–95 % of cases [ 24, 32 ]. WebDISCUSSION. Although PVNS usually affects the knee, 1– 14 it is not common. The arthroscopic incidence is estimated to be 1 in 250, with a yearly incidence of 1.8 cases per million population. 1 A quarter of these are of the localised form. 1 Original descriptions date back to Chassaignac 150 years ago. 11 A diffuse form in the knee was reported in 1909, …
